Y'all be careful. People will respond to your messages pretending to be the person you are trying to get ahold of. Make sure it is the same person who posted the ad. They got me because I didn't catch it.
 
Thanks for the heads up.

Please also report this directly to the mods (PM one of them). They may not see this thread, but they may be able to shut down the person who messaged you if you report this to them.
 
Y'all be careful. People will respond to your messages pretending to be the person you are trying to get ahold of. Make sure it is the same person who posted the ad. They got me because I didn't catch it.
You got hit because you put your email address in a response to an ad. Scammers don't need accounts to harvest emails or cell #'s.

We are supposed to use the PM system for initial contact. That way, you're nearly ensured that you're interacting with the person you think you're interacting with.

Then, using a payment method with buyer protection helps fill in any gaps with other things that might go wrong with a transaction.

Never put your phone # or email out for public consumption on any buy/sell site, not just this one. Use the "Start Conversation" function to contact the seller privately.
